Tamiya M4A3E8 Sherman On The Bench

Well I could not resist starting this kit so here you are, the start of what I expect to be a very easy and enjoyable build. So far everything has gone together extremely well, and quickly too! The suspension is only made up of four parts plus the wheels so that all helps to speed things up. Also the upper and lower hull parts fit like you would expect from Tamiya.

Secret Projects And Other News

Everything has conspired to keep me away from the bench since returning from holiday, be it training courses or life in general. However I have had some bench time building the Takom Chieftain Mk5 in Iranian guise which when completed will appear in a future issue of Tamiya model magazine international. Unfortunately I can't show you any pictures yet until it's published but I will say the kit builds up really well and is light years ahead of the old Tamiya Chieftain. 

One secret project I can now share has just been published in the March issue of Tamiya model magazine. It's the new re-boxing from Tamiya of the Italeri M24 Chaffee. The remit for this was a straight out of the box build and I must say it was really fun to build it this way. Painting it was also a blast and the inclusion of stowage and a figure in the box was an added bonus.  


















The article features a detailed account of the build and I'm very pleased to have it published. So normal service is almost resumed at the bench!
